Lions Club feeds students with disabilities
28 Nov 2018
Lions Club, Serowe Branch, prepared a luncheon for students of Makolojwane Primary School with learning disabilities, a gesture meant to spread love and compassion.
Speaking during the luncheon that also doubled as a Christmas present to the pupils, Lions Club Serowe branch secretary, Ms Winnie Ntabe-Jagwere said the organisation was touched and alive to the challenges of such pupils, especially those with hearing impairment.
She said the lunch was an opportune time for them to meet with the pupils and accord them quality time while appreciating the challenges they went through.
In appreciating the gesture extended by Lions Club, senior teacher, languages and interpretation, Ms Oageletse Mosarwe said that such benevolence would go a long way in motivating their learners and the same would rub off on them so they could spread compassion and love in future. ENDS
